Programming Codes
Function
Turn ON/OFF Double-Strike Mode
ASCII
[ESC] G <n>
Hexadecimal 1BH 47H <n>
Decimal
<27> <71> <n>
0  n  255
Range
Description The [ESC] G <n> command turns on or off double-strike mode. When the least
significant bit (LSB) of <n> = 1, double-strike mode is turned on; when it is 0,
double-strike mode is turned off. The default setting is <n> = 0. Double-strike
and emphasized printing appear the same.
Function
Turn ON/OFF Upside-Down Print Mode
ASCII
[ESC] { <n>
Hexadecimal 1BH 7BH <n>
Decimal
<27> <123> <n>
0  n  255
Range
Description The [ESC] { <n> turns on or off upside-down printing mode. When the least
significant bit of <n> = 1, upside-down printing mode is turned on; when it is 0,
upside-down printing mode is turned off. The default setting is <n> = 0. When
upside-down mode is turned on, the printer prints 180 rotated characters from
right to left. The line printing order is not reversed, so the order of the data
transmitted is important.
